Emerging Themes

This publication summarises

the major themes, issues and concerns arising in the inquiry. Following

a brief description of the numbers, locations and schooling arrangements

of rural and remote students (Chapter 2), these themes are organised under

the chapter titles

  • Availability and accessibility

    of schools

  • Schooling quality
  • Students with disabilities
  • Indigenous students

The publication concludes with

an overview of the human rights provisions relevant to rural and remote

school education (Chapter 7).
